Describe the Pact which was signed counter to NATO.

NATO or the North Atlantic Treaty Organization is the military alliance formed between the United States and its European allies to resist Soviet aggression in Europe in 1949. To counter NATO, the Soviet Union organised the Soviet bloc countries for united military action, under the Warsaw Pact. In December 1954, a conference of eight nations namely Albania, Bulgaria, Hungary, Romania, Czechoslovakia, East Germany, Poland, Romania and Russia took place in Moscow following which they concluded the treaty on May 14, 1955. A joint command of the armed forces of the member countries with headquarters in Moscow was setup. The pact was dissolved in 1991 following the disintegration of Soviet Union.
